| 10 | // This file just defines some symbols found in COFF documentation. They are |
| 11 | // used to emit function type information for COFF targets (Cygwin/Mingw32). |
| 12 | // |
| 13 | //===----------------------------------------------------------------------===// |
| 14 | |
| 15 | #ifndef X86COFF_H |
| 16 | #define X86COFF_H |
| 17 | |
| 18 | namespace COFF |
| 19 | { |
Anton Korobeynikov | 1e0f338 | 2007-01-16 18:23:09 +0000 | [diff] [blame] | 20 | /// Storage class tells where and what the symbol represents |
Anton Korobeynikov | d05ca65 | 2007-01-16 16:41:57 +0000 | [diff] [blame] | 21 | enum StorageClass { |
Anton Korobeynikov | 1e0f338 | 2007-01-16 18:23:09 +0000 | [diff] [blame] | 22 | C_EFCN = -1, ///< Physical end of function |
| 23 | C_NULL = 0, ///< No symbol |
| 24 | C_AUTO = 1, ///< External definition |
| 25 | C_EXT = 2, ///< External symbol |
| 26 | C_STAT = 3, ///< Static |
| 27 | C_REG = 4, ///< Register variable |
| 28 | C_EXTDEF = 5, ///< External definition |
| 29 | C_LABEL = 6, ///< Label |
| 30 | C_ULABEL = 7, ///< Undefined label |
| 31 | C_MOS = 8, ///< Member of structure |
| 32 | C_ARG = 9, ///< Function argument |
| 33 | C_STRTAG = 10, ///< Structure tag |
| 34 | C_MOU = 11, ///< Member of union |
| 35 | C_UNTAG = 12, ///< Union tag |
| 36 | C_TPDEF = 13, ///< Type definition |
| 37 | C_USTATIC = 14, ///< Undefined static |
| 38 | C_ENTAG = 15, ///< Enumeration tag |
| 39 | C_MOE = 16, ///< Member of enumeration |
| 40 | C_REGPARM = 17, ///< Register parameter |
| 41 | C_FIELD = 18, ///< Bit field |
Anton Korobeynikov | d05ca65 | 2007-01-16 16:41:57 +0000 | [diff] [blame] | 42 | |
Anton Korobeynikov | 1e0f338 | 2007-01-16 18:23:09 +0000 | [diff] [blame] | 43 | C_BLOCK = 100, ///< ".bb" or ".eb" - beginning or end of block |
| 44 | C_FCN = 101, ///< ".bf" or ".ef" - beginning or end of function |
| 45 | C_EOS = 102, ///< End of structure |
| 46 | C_FILE = 103, ///< File name |
| 47 | C_LINE = 104, ///< Line number, reformatted as symbol |
| 48 | C_ALIAS = 105, ///< Duplicate tag |
| 49 | C_HIDDEN = 106 ///< External symbol in dmert public lib |
Anton Korobeynikov | d05ca65 | 2007-01-16 16:41:57 +0000 | [diff] [blame] | 50 | }; |
| 51 | |
Anton Korobeynikov | 1e0f338 | 2007-01-16 18:23:09 +0000 | [diff] [blame] | 52 | /// The type of the symbol. This is made up of a base type and a derived type. |
| 53 | /// For example, pointer to int is "pointer to T" and "int" |
Anton Korobeynikov | d05ca65 | 2007-01-16 16:41:57 +0000 | [diff] [blame] | 54 | enum SymbolType { |
Anton Korobeynikov | 1e0f338 | 2007-01-16 18:23:09 +0000 | [diff] [blame] | 55 | T_NULL = 0, ///< No type info |
| 56 | T_ARG = 1, ///< Void function argument (only used by compiler) |
| 57 | T_VOID = 1, ///< The same as above. Just named differently in some specs. |
| 58 | T_CHAR = 2, ///< Character |
| 59 | T_SHORT = 3, ///< Short integer |
| 60 | T_INT = 4, ///< Integer |
| 61 | T_LONG = 5, ///< Long integer |
| 62 | T_FLOAT = 6, ///< Floating point |
| 63 | T_DOUBLE = 7, ///< Double word |
| 64 | T_STRUCT = 8, ///< Structure |
| 65 | T_UNION = 9, ///< Union |
| 66 | T_ENUM = 10, ///< Enumeration |
| 67 | T_MOE = 11, ///< Member of enumeration |
| 68 | T_UCHAR = 12, ///< Unsigned character |
| 69 | T_USHORT = 13, ///< Unsigned short |
| 70 | T_UINT = 14, ///< Unsigned integer |
| 71 | T_ULONG = 15 ///< Unsigned long |
Anton Korobeynikov | d05ca65 | 2007-01-16 16:41:57 +0000 | [diff] [blame] | 72 | }; |
| 73 | |
Anton Korobeynikov | 1e0f338 | 2007-01-16 18:23:09 +0000 | [diff] [blame] | 74 | /// Derived type of symbol |
Anton Korobeynikov | d05ca65 | 2007-01-16 16:41:57 +0000 | [diff] [blame] | 75 | enum SymbolDerivedType { |
Anton Korobeynikov | 1e0f338 | 2007-01-16 18:23:09 +0000 | [diff] [blame] | 76 | DT_NON = 0, ///< No derived type |
| 77 | DT_PTR = 1, ///< Pointer to T |
| 78 | DT_FCN = 2, ///< Function returning T |
| 79 | DT_ARY = 3 ///< Array of T |
Anton Korobeynikov | d05ca65 | 2007-01-16 16:41:57 +0000 | [diff] [blame] | 80 | }; |
| 81 | |
Anton Korobeynikov | 1e0f338 | 2007-01-16 18:23:09 +0000 | [diff] [blame] | 82 | /// Masks for extracting parts of type |
| 83 | enum SymbolTypeMasks { |
| 84 | N_BTMASK = 017, ///< Mask for base type |
| 85 | N_TMASK = 060 ///< Mask for derived type |
| 86 | }; |
| 87 | |
| 88 | /// Offsets of parts of type |
| 89 | enum Shifts { |
Anton Korobeynikov | b93a7c9 | 2007-01-16 20:22:18 +0000 | [diff] [blame] | 90 | N_BTSHFT = 4 ///< Type is formed as (base + derived << N_BTSHIFT) |
Anton Korobeynikov | d05ca65 | 2007-01-16 16:41:57 +0000 | [diff] [blame] | 91 | }; |
